<p>I am always amazed at where the inspiration for room design comes from, as we try to recreate a space that reflects our fundamental tenets of African-inspired design.  The notion that it takes us to our interpretation of deco was initially somewhat of a surprise.</p>
<p><a href="http://ethnicitidesign.files.wordpress.com/2011/04/africandeco01.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-1146" title="AfricanDeco01" src="http://ethnicitidesign.files.wordpress.com/2011/04/africandeco01.jpg?w=500&#038;h=337" alt="" width="500" height="337" /></a></p>
<p>Of course many famous artists, the likes of Picasso, used the impression of the Shona stone sculptures of Zimbabwe to define an overall approach to his art.  Similarly furniture designers from the Harlem Renaissance period combined the shapes and exotic textiles for a contemporary ethnic look.</p>
<p><a href="http://ethnicitidesign.files.wordpress.com/2011/04/africandeco06.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-1150" title="AfricanDeco06" src="http://ethnicitidesign.files.wordpress.com/2011/04/africandeco06.jpg?w=500&#038;h=396" alt="" width="500" height="396" /></a></p>
<p>Following that lead we incorporated these shapes and patterns with a intriguing palette of blue, black sea foam, and pink in an attempt to break away from the dated safari image.  The use of traditional African wax fabrics reinforces the light and airy feel we were looking to achieve.</p>
<p>Another counterpoint that works is the generous use of floral arrangements of plant material pulled from the mood board expands and fills the room with color and intriguing forms.</p>

				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://ethnicitidesign.files.wordpress.com/2011/02/coastalbreezes04.jpg"><img class="alignleft size-full wp-image-1110" title="CoastalBreezes04" src="http://ethnicitidesign.files.wordpress.com/2011/02/coastalbreezes04.jpg?w=500" alt=""   /></a>The reefs that lie in the turquoise and azure waters of Africa&#8217;s tropical west coast are among the richest environments on earth.  These gloried places provide us the inspiration to create the essence of our dining room.  Reaching for a concept that would combine both functional and aesthetic components, we chose a palette drawn from the sea with a backdrop of wood-and-stone artifact images.</p>
<p>The room is anchored by the dining presentation that consists of a custom table top along with table linens that set the stage.  With images by American photographer Ron Tarver, the room has takes on a contemporary attitude.</p>
<p><a href="http://ethnicitidesign.files.wordpress.com/2011/02/coastalbreezes061.jpg"><img class="alignleft size-full wp-image-1115" title="CoastalBreezes06" src="http://ethnicitidesign.files.wordpress.com/2011/02/coastalbreezes061.jpg?w=500&#038;h=318" alt="" width="500" height="318" /></a>In order to unify the space we have created a custom buffet and cabinet collection that allows us to bring the color statement around the room in a substantial way.</p>
<p>In keeping with the objective of simplicity, the widow treatment consists of a pair of custom screens and window panels. We have featured in this room, as part of our love of African textiles, coordinated wax prints.</p>
<p><a href="http://ethnicitidesign.files.wordpress.com/2011/02/windowtreatment01.jpg"><img class="alignleft size-full wp-image-1117" title="WindowTreatment01" src="http://ethnicitidesign.files.wordpress.com/2011/02/windowtreatment01.jpg?w=500&#038;h=365" alt="" width="500" height="365" /></a></p>
<p>The feature wall is anchored by wax fabric and a buffet.  This allows for a dramatic backdrop for a personal collection of family treasures.</p>

				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>It has always been ethniciti&#8217;s belief that African-inspired textiles are perhaps the most visual interpretation of the culture.  While apparel designers have most recently begun to show African textiles in their fashion design, there have been few examples in comprehensive home fashion collections.</p>
<p>As designers we have always been attracted to African wax fabric for its amazing patterns and colors.  Just recently ethniciti has been offered the opportunity to develop a show home for a developer of high-end condos.  The strategy is to create spaces based on ethniciti design concepts, featuring African wax textiles as the center of a marketing program directed at prospective buyers who would be attracted to modern African-inspired home fashions.</p>
